How to Know When to Replace Your Oil Filter

09 September 2025

How to Know When to Replace Your Oil Filter

Maintaining your car doesn't have to be difficult. Preventative checks and timely replacement can have it running like new for decades. One of the most neglected components of a car is the oil filter. Small though it may be, it does an enormous job in keeping your engine alive by catching dirt and debris before they become a problem.
